Building a Strong Case: Evidence & Testimony

Building a robust defense strategy in sexual assault cases requires meticulous attention to detail and an in-depth understanding of legal principles. Missouri rape lawyers play a pivotal role in guiding clients through this complex process, ensuring their rights are protected. Evidence and testimony are the cornerstones of any criminal case, and for sexual assault, these elements demand special consideration.
Expert legal counsel will closely examine all available evidence, including medical records, DNA reports, 911 calls, and witness testimonies. In Missouri, the burden of proof lies with the prosecution, meaning they must present compelling evidence to secure a conviction. A skilled rape lawyer in Missouri will cross-examine witnesses and challenge the admissibility of evidence to weaken the state’s case. For instance, they may question the reliability of eyewitness testimony or scrutinize any potential contamination of physical evidence.
The strategic use of expert witnesses is another critical aspect. Forensic experts, psychologists, and medical professionals can provide crucial insights and help reconstruct the events leading up to and during the alleged assault. These specialists offer an objective perspective, which can counterbalance the emotional nature of such cases.
